Richard Hall Comunity Mental Health Center Somerset County

Richard Hall Comunity Mental Health Center Somerset County is a mental health treatment center in Somerset County, NJ, located at 500 North Bridge Street, 8807 zip code area. Richard Hall Comunity Mental Health Center Somerset County provides outpatient treatment and telemedicine/telehealth. Richard Hall Comunity Mental Health Center Somerset County offers couples/family therapy, activity therapy and psychotropic medication to adults, young adults and seniors 65 or older. Richard Hall Comunity Mental Health Center Somerset County also supports people with HIV or AIDS, clients referred from the court/judicial system and LGBT. Additional services at Richard Hall Comunity Mental Health Center Somerset County consist of suicide prevention services, family psychoeducation and court-ordered outpatient treatment.

Center For Discovery Bridgewater

Center For Discovery Bridgewater is a mental health clinic in Somerset County, New Jersey, located at 745 Route 202, Suite 103, 8807 zip code. Center For Discovery Bridgewater offers outpatient treatment. Center For Discovery Bridgewater provides behavior modification, individual psychotherapy and cognitive behavioral therapy to young adults, adults and children / adolescents. Center For Discovery Bridgewater also supports people with PTSD, patients with eating disorders and LGBT. Some other services provided by Center For Discovery Bridgewater include diet and exercise counseling, family psychoeducation and case management.

Hackensack Meridian Health Carrier Clinic

Hackensack Meridian Health Carrier Clinic is a mental health treatment clinic in Somerset County, New Jersey, located at 252 County Road Route 601, 8502 zip code. Hackensack Meridian Health Carrier Clinic provides outpatient treatment, residential treatment and telemedicine/telehealth. Hackensack Meridian Health Carrier Clinic provides trauma therapy, electroconvulsive therapy and integrated dual diagnosis disorder treatment to young adults, children / adolescents and adults. Hackensack Meridian Health Carrier Clinic also supports people requiring dual diagnosis treatment, people with Alzheimer's or dementia and people with PTSD. Additional services provided by Hackensack Meridian Health Carrier Clinic consist of suicide prevention services, diet and exercise counseling and family psychoeducation.

  • How much does mental health treatment cost in Somerset County?

    Costs for mental health treatment in Somerset County will vary depending on the facility and your particular mental health issues. Such costs can go as high as $12,000 for inpatient treatment, or as low as $60 hourly for outpatient treatment. Please note, however, that you may not need to pay for mental health costs out of pocket. If your health insurance provider pays for mental health services, they may be able to cover some or all costs associated with your treatment.
